WELCOME TO MY COUNSELLING SPACE

I’m an integrative counsellor, and I offer a kind, supportive space where you can talk openly and feel heard. I work with people facing many different challenges, including anxiety, low mood, trauma, relationship difficulties, infertility, and life changes such as menopause or loss. My aim is to help you make sense of what’s happening in your life and find a way forward that feels manageable and true to you.

 Experienced Professional:

I am a trained Integrative Counsellor with experience supporting people through a wide range of challenges and life transitions. My training allows me to draw from different therapeutic approaches to suit each individual’s needs, creating a space for growth and healing.

I completed a counselling placement at a women’s counselling service, where I supported women navigating life changes and personal difficulties. I also gained valuable counselling experience working within supported housing for people affected by homelessness, trauma, and addiction.

I have developed my private practice, offering counselling to clients from diverse backgrounds. My approach is empathetic, client-led, and grounded in the belief that every person has the capacity for change and self-understanding.

A Safe and Comfortable Space:

I offer sessions in a welcoming room at the Emmaus site in Portslade. The space is designed to help you feel calm and at ease. I also offer online sessions, so you can connect with me from the comfort of your home, whether via Doxy, Google Meet, or phone. My counselling service is available for individuals (over 16 years old)

Fees & Accessibility:

My sessions are £55 for 50 minutes. I offer a free 15-minute consultation so we can ensure we’re a good fit for each other. I understand that everyone’s circumstances are different, and the cost of therapy can sometimes be a barrier. To help make support more accessible, I offer concessionary rates for anyone who may need them.
